Web4. Inspect the firewood before storing it in the garage. Ideally, you should season the firewood for 6-12 months outside before bringing it inside. This way the firewood is ready to be used and it will have a lot lower water content than fresh wood. Make sure to check the firewood before storing it in your garage, the firewood should be dry ... WebOct 22, 2024 · While there are many variations of firewood stacking methods, all tend to follow the same basic principles: The cut ends should be left out in the open and exposed to the elements. The wood should be kept off the ground and at least a couple of inches away from any walls. The wood should be stacked loosely enough that it can breathe and dry ...
